| contents | Gifted/Talented Curriculum Bulletin No. 1: Getting Started. Goldman, Nancy T. Cognitive Development Creative Development Elementary Secondary Education Gifted Learning Activities Preschool Education Resource Materials Talent Teaching Methods Intended for gifted/talented staff members, the document provides a collection of curriculum ideas and suggestions for activities, books, and articles related to education of gifted and talented children. Included are materials (outlines, tables, diagrams, and articles) on the following topics: facts about famous individuals; introduction of higher level thinking skills at upper and lower grade levels; the enrichment triad model; vocabulary development; the Astor program for 4- to 6-year-old gifted children; development of thinking skills through creative learning centers; setting up a classroom library; classroom-tested teaching ideas; high-quality, low cost learning materials; suggestions for teaching reading and mathematics; and a list of resource materials on program planning and evaluation, curriculum aids, materials for parents of gifted children, and standardized test/instrument suggestions.
